Ingredients
Scale
Filling:
- 6 cups fresh or frozen sliced peaches (peeled if fresh)
- 3/4 cup granulated sugar
- 1/4 cup brown sugar
- 1 tablespoon lemon juice
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1/2 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- 1/4 teaspoon ground nutmeg
- 2 teaspoons cornstarch
Topping:
- 1 cup all-purpose flour
- 1/4 cup granulated sugar (for topping)
- 1/4 cup brown sugar (for topping)
- 1 teaspoon baking powder
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 6 tablespoons unsalted butter (cold and cubed)
- 1/4 cup boiling water
Instructions
- Preheat the oven: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C).
- Mix peach filling: In a large bowl, combine sliced peaches, sugars, lemon juice, vanilla, spices, and cornstarch. Mix well.
- Prepare topping: In another bowl, mix flour, sugars, baking powder, and salt. Cut in butter until crumbly. Stir in boiling water.
- Assemble and bake: Transfer peach mixture to a baking dish, top with spoonfuls of topping. Bake for 40-45 minutes until golden and bubbly. Cool slightly before serving.
Notes
- You can use frozen or canned peaches as substitutes.
- Enhance the dessert by serving it with vanilla ice cream or whipped cream.
